Mother Russia (Fe song)

On 4 October 2013, Fe announced via Facebook that she will be posting a "smokey" track that night.

[2] Nine hours later, she finally released "Mother Russia" as her third independent single.

Indie music blog Pigeons & Planes said that the song is "a little more than an organ, some ambient strings, and Fe's soft, pillowy voice cooing in your ear."

[4] Clyde Barretto of Prefixmag.com described the song as "sweet and chilling as vanila ice cream".

[5] Music blog My Day By Day Music wrote, "daring you to kiss the mist, Fe's icy vocals whisper majestically from her latest track 'Mother Russia', pining seductively beneath a whirlwind of haunting choral synths, echoey vocals and twinkling chimes.
